As Dave puts it, ALWDD is the show about news and politics with a life beyond news and politics. To be sure there is plenty of discussion of the news of the day, both local and national (and of course international) but he also blends in a nice mix of the light and the interesting.
For example every Thursday he spends an hour of the show discussing the Constitution, trying to offer the listener a simple yet insightful look at the provisions of our founding document.
Friday afternoons include an hour called Fun With News where he and his producer John take a look at some of the odder (and usually bemusing) stories from around the world.
Dave himself is an interesting guy. He grew up in a family committed to charitable works and public service and with that in mind he spent a number of years in the US Navy, serving aboard a submarine.
After his naval service he returned the the charity world before finding his way into local talk radio.
Dave’s show airs Monday through Friday from 3-6pm (Pacific Time) on KFIV 1360 in Modesto California.
